EnglishThe finding of a possible Barbarian graffito in one of the pylons of the temple of Debod offers the opportunity to review some of the ways in which a hypothetical Blemmyan (or, at least, Barbarian) presence could have taken place in Debod. The cultural implications of the inscription are considered and a reading and a chronology for it are also proposed.
